Chicago’s Star Events starts season with bang May 17-19

WHAT: Start your summer off right with the season’s first street festival. The 17th annual Mayfest will bring traditional festival food, ice cold Budweiser and refreshing Rex-Goliath Wines, and some of Chicago’s favorite headlining musical talent to Lakeview during the three-day event.

A number of popular bands will take to the stage throughout Mayfest, including local favorites 16 Candles, This Must be the Band, Mr. Blotto, Too White Crew, and Hairbangers Ball, among others.

Also highlighting the Mayfest celebrations will be Chicago Kids Day on Saturday, May 18th from 10:00 a.m. – 2:00 p.m. A celebration of children’s health and wellness, Chicago Kids Day will encourage families to be healthy together through a variety of activities including health and posture screenings, arts and crafts sessions, kid’s zumba, boot camps, and more.

Chicago’s Pet Pageant and Expo will also take center stage on Sunday, May 19th from 11:00 a.m. – 2:00 p.m. Presented by Higgins Animal Clinic, this unique event allows Chicagoans the chance to enjoy the summer sun with their furry friends.

Mayfest is produced by Star Events.  Admission to the event is $10, with proceeds benefiting local community organizations such as the YMCA and Neighborhood Parent Network. More information on Star Events can be found at www.starevents.com, or on Star Events’ Facebook or Twitter.

The Loop’s Italian mainstay, 312 Chicago, will be celebrating its 15th Anniversary on March 12, 2013! To celebrate, Executive Chef Luca Corazzina is embracing their senior status with a special three-course “Everything’s Better with Age” anniversary menu. Each course will feature a savory “aged” ingredient:

 

  • First Course: “Prosciutto e Capesante” 18-Month Aged Prosciutto Wrapped Scallops with Mini Sweet Pepper and Fava Bean Puree
  • Second Course: “Bistecca Stagionata con Patatine Fritte” 24-Day Dry-Aged Rib-Eye with Provolone Cheese, Crispy Onion Strings, Procini Mushrooms and Housemade Fries
  • Third Course: “Torte di Banana” Banana Bread Cake with Fior di Latte Gelato and a 25-Year-Old Aged Chocolate Balsamic

 

The “Everything’s Better with Age” tasting menu will be available March 12-17, for $40 per person. The menu will also feature wine and cocktail pairings, such as: Old Vine wines and Barrel-Aged Manhattans. To make a reservation or for more information visit,www.312chicago.com.

Just days before St. Patrick’s Day, South Loop-located City Tavern will hold a Moylan’s beer dinner. On Wednesday, March 13 at 7 p.m., participating guests will enjoy a welcome reception followed by three course menu, paired with Moylan’s brews. The fee to attend is $45, or $40 if a reservation is placed by March 6 (tax and gratuity excluded). Executive Chef Robert Hoffman’s complete menu is outlined below. Please call City Tavern at 312.663.1278 to reserve a seat at this Irish-inspired event.

Moylan’s beers, out of Novato, California, have won global recognition in the Great American Beer Festival, The California State Fair and the World Beer Cup.
